MINUTES — Management Meeting, Logistics Provider Change
Present: heads of department; chair: R. Calloway.

1. Ferrowin Freight contract ends Q2; service failures noted in the Dunmore corridor.
2. Agreed: transition to Larkspan Logistics, phased over eight weeks.
3. Warehousing team to map handover risks by Friday.
4. Comms hold until supplier notification complete.
5. No headcount impact expected.

Actions assigned per department. The commercial terms driving this switch are recorded in the confidential note below.

management briefing: Istaelix Group is in early talks to buy Sorysax Logistics for about $496.2 million. The Kasox launch date is October 3, and nothing goes to the press before then. Legal wants the Norokax Foods term sheet withdrawn before April 25.

Runbook: Retention Sweeper (Project Lanthorn). The sweeper runs nightly at 02:10 and deletes records older than the tenant's retention window. Before escalating a missing-data ticket, confirm the tenant's policy in the admin console and check the sweeper's last-run status — a failed run leaves a red banner. Never restart the sweeper mid-pass; it is safe to resume only after the lock file clears. Step-by-step recovery instructions, including dry-run mode, are documented on the following internal page.

wiki page, tahaf-tajog: https://jira.ordindyn.corp/pipeline

### Changed defaults — Sqlint-Parade v2.3

Heads up for the sync: uppercase keyword enforcement is now on by default, and the max line length for SQL files dropped to 100. Trailing semicolon checks moved from warning to error. Existing repos inherit these unless overridden. The new default rule set ships as the following configuration.

deployment values, yadug-bawif:
[framir]
team = pelox
access_code = ac_a38ab2
owner = tamion.julael
host = framir.tolvaqlabs.test
port = 11211
peer = tammir.zemvargrid.local
salt = 2215ef03
pin = 1541

Fan-out backpressure note for plugin authors. The Krellin notification bus now throttles slow consumers instead of buffering indefinitely. If your plugin's webhook sink lags past the window, deliveries pause and CI flags your integration test as stalled, not failed. Drain faster or ack in batches. Retest after changes; the harness writes the run token on the line below this note.

pipeline stamp: htk31_f769b577b3028a4e9958e5bb8d1259a